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Ashy Tailorbird | Philippine tarsier |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Aves (Birds)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Passeriformes (Songbirds) | Primates (Primates) |
| Family | Cisticolidae | Tarsiidae |
| Genus | Orthotomus | Carlito |
| Species | Orthotomus ruficeps | Carlito syrichta |
Evolutionary Relationship
Ashy Tailorbird and Philippine tarsier share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
